A two-tailed test is performed at 95% confidence. The p-value is determined to be 0.09. The null hypothesis: a. Must be rejected b. Should not be rejected c. Could be rejected, depending on the sample size d. Has been designed incorrectly

Answers

The correct answer is (b) Should not be rejected.

In hypothesis testing, the p-value represents the probability of obtaining a test statistic as extreme or more extreme than the observed one, assuming the null hypothesis is true. In a two-tailed test, we compare the p-value to the significance level divided by 2 (α/2) on each tail of the distribution. If the p-value is greater than α/2, we fail to reject the null hypothesis.

In this case, the p-value is determined to be 0.09, which is greater than the significance level of 0.05. Therefore, we do not have sufficient evidence to reject the null hypothesis at the 95% confidence level. The p-value being greater than the significance level indicates that the observed data is reasonably consistent with the null hypothesis, and we do not have enough evidence to support the alternative hypothesis.

In summary, the p-value of 0.09 suggests that we should not reject the null hypothesis at the 95% confidence level, indicating that the results are not statistically significant to conclude an effect or difference based on the available evidence.

Circle A has twice the radius of circle B. Which of the following is true of the ratio of the circumference to the diameter of these two circles?
a. The ratio of circle A is twice the ratio of circle B.
b. The ratio of circle A is half the ratio of circle B.
c. The ratio of circle A is equal to the ratio of circle B.
d. It is impossible to compare these ratios without more information.

Answers

the correct answer is (c) The ratio of circle A is equal to the ratio of circle B, as the ratio of the circumference to the diameter is the same for both circles.

In a circle, the ratio of the circumference to the diameter is constant and is denoted by the mathematical constant π (pi), which is approximately equal to 3.14159. This means that for any circle, regardless of its size or radius, the ratio of the circumference to the diameter will always be the same.

Since circle A has twice the radius of circle B, it means that the circumference of circle A will be twice the circumference of circle B. Similarly, the diameter of circle A will also be twice the diameter of circle B. Therefore, when we calculate the ratio of the circumference to the diameter for both circles, we will obtain the same value, which is π.

if we find that the null hypothesis, h0:βj=0h0:βj=0, cannot be rejected when testing the contribution of an individual regressor variable to the model, we usually should:

Answers

If we find that the null hypothesis, H0: βj = 0, cannot be rejected when testing the contribution of an individual regressor variable to the model, we usually should consider removing that variable from the model.

When the null hypothesis cannot be rejected, it suggests that there is not enough evidence to support the claim that the specific regressor variable has a significant impact on the model's outcome. In such cases, including the variable in the model may not improve the model's predictive power or provide meaningful insights.

Removing the non-significant variable can help simplify the model and reduce complexity. It can also improve interpretability by focusing on the variables that have a more substantial effect on the response variable.

However, it is important to carefully consider the context, theoretical relevance, and potential confounding factors before removing a variable solely based on its lack of significance. Additionally, consulting with domain experts and considering the overall model performance are crucial steps in the decision-making process.

Pearson's r is the technical term for the correlation coefficient most often used in psychological research.
true/false

Answers

True. Pearson's r is indeed the technical term for the correlation coefficient that is most often used in psychological research. The correlation coefficient measures the strength and direction of the linear relationship between two variables. It quantifies the extent to which changes in one variable are associated with changes in the other variable.

Pearson's correlation coefficient, denoted by the symbol r, is specifically used to assess the linear relationship between two continuous variables. It ranges from -1 to 1, where a value of -1 indicates a perfect negative linear relationship, 1 indicates a perfect positive linear relationship, and 0 indicates no linear relationship.

Psychological research often involves examining the relationships between various psychological constructs, such as intelligence and academic performance, self-esteem and mental health, or stress and job satisfaction. Correlation analysis using Pearson's r allows researchers to determine the strength and direction of these relationships.

By calculating Pearson's correlation coefficient, researchers can assess the degree of association between variables and make informed interpretations about the nature and strength of the relationship. This information is valuable in understanding patterns, making predictions, and informing interventions or treatments in psychological research and practice.
